Mansfield Town boss David Flitcroft rates Harry Kewell as being a '˜top performer' and praises Crawley Town
The Stags lie three points off the play-off places and will be looking to make sure of taking three points from the game while hoping Morecambe can do them a favour.
He does not see the visiting Reds as being easy opponents though and praised their style of play.

Hide AdFlitcroft said: “Crawley are of the better football teams in the league.
“You look at the teams that have gone up and the teams in the play-offs and they are strong teams - robust and quite direct.
“But Crawley have tried to do it a different way. They move the ball around the pitch really well to create opportunities from different angles.
“They’ve just been on a poor run. There seems to be some uncertainty at the club that I just can’t put my finger on as it’s a club that January/February time I thought was going to threaten the top-seven.

Hide Ad“Their manager has been a top performer and he’s come and got his hands dirty in a difficult league. They will want to finish on a high themselves.”
Mansfield boss Flitcroft has ordered his players to ‘take care of business’ on Saturday while hoping on Morecambe doing him a favour by beating Coventry City.
Mansfield go into Saturday’s huge home clash with struggling Crawley Town three points adrift of the play-offs, but a win coupled with a defeat for either Lincoln City at home to Yeovil or Coventry City by Morecambe would see Stags steal back in there at the death.
